Steppe Armchair, by Covet House, is a comfortable and appealing seating piece for your hotel reception design, upholstered in a soft moss green velvet and a subtle metal champagne foot. In physical geography, a steppe is an ecoregion characterized by grassland plains without trees apart from those near rivers and lakes, another very familiar landscape in Patagonia, which served as the inspiration for the natural curves and shapes of Steppe Armchair.
Kooch Center Table, by Covet House, is a homage to the nomadic people in the Patagonian area, symbolizing the variation in size of the tribes and their later occupation, represented here by the metal champagne circles, perfect for a hotel reception design. The round shape of the Patagonia marble top represents the sky, where these tribes believed that Kooch, their God, was watching over.
